Why One Workshop a Year Isn't Enough: The Case for Leadership Communities in Schools

Most schools invest in leadership development the same way they invest in a good dinner out — meaningful in the moment, satisfying while it lasts, and largely forgotten by the following week. An annual retreat. A conference in the fall. A speaker at the opening faculty meeting. The intentions are genuine. But isolated events, no matter how well designed, cannot produce the kind of sustained leadership growth that schools genuinely need — especially when those schools are in the middle of strategic change. Leadership Communities are a different model entirely: a year-long, cohort-based program that develops leadership capacity continuously, connects development directly to real strategic work, and builds capability that stays inside the institution long after the engagement ends.
